Debate Over Moving Champions League Final Beyond Europe

Recent discussions have sparked debate on whether the UEFA Champions League final could potentially be hosted outside of Europe due to limited options for suitable venues. With the increasing challenges of finding appropriate host cities and stadiums meeting UEFA's stringent requirements, the possibility of moving the prestigious final to locations such as the United States or the Middle East is being considered.

Challenges in Selecting Host Cities

Despite the allure of hosting the Champions League final and the economic benefits it brings to the chosen city, UEFA is facing a practical challenge in securing suitable venues for future finals. The stringent criteria set by UEFA, including a minimum stadium capacity of 65,000, extensive infrastructure, and accommodation for supporters and media, have significantly narrowed down the list of potential host cities.

Potential Overseas Venues and Considerations

While discussions have emerged regarding the feasibility of hosting the final in locations like the United States, concerns remain about moving the event outside of Europe. The success of high-profile matches in international locations, coupled with the commercial opportunities presented, has led to speculation about the future direction of the Champions League final.

UEFA's Decision-Making Process

Despite calls for a global expansion of the Champions League final, UEFA President Aleksandar Ceferin has emphasized the importance of keeping European football events within the continent. While plans for league games in overseas locations have been met with mixed reactions, the prospect of moving the Champions League final abroad continues to be a topic of discussion within the football community.

With limited options for future host cities and the necessity to adhere to strict requirements for the event, UEFA faces a pivotal choice between maintaining a reduced roster of traditional European venues or exploring the possibility of taking the final to a global stage.

Potential Impact on Football Landscape

The debate over the future location of the Champions League final reflects broader discussions within the football landscape about the globalization of the sport. As major football organizations and brands expand their presence worldwide, the prospect of moving iconic events like the Champions League final to new locations raises questions about tradition, fan accessibility, and the commercialization of the game.
